From c26084091fdd5ca55dee4f8c7118475ade8ce1b9 Mon Sep 17 00:00:00 2001 From: Dylan De Faoite Date: Thu, 18 Dec 2025 15:17:40 +0000 Subject: [PATCH] ADD argparse import to clip.py, create example.config.toml, and reorganize imports in paths.py and video.py --- rewind/clip.py | 3 ++- example.config.toml => rewind/example.config.toml | 0 rewind/paths.py | 5 ++++- rewind/video.py | 6 ++++-- 4 files changed, 10 insertions(+), 4 deletions(-) rename example.config.toml => rewind/example.config.toml (100%) diff --git a/rewind/clip.py b/rewind/clip.py index 094f032..be2e8d5 100755 --- a/rewind/clip.py +++ b/rewind/clip.py @@ -1,6 +1,7 @@ #!/usr/bin/env python3 +import sys +import argparse from rewind.video import clip -import sys, argparse def build_parser() -> argparse.ArgumentParser: parser = argparse.ArgumentParser( diff --git a/example.config.toml b/rewind/example.config.toml similarity index 100% rename from example.config.toml rename to rewind/example.config.toml diff --git a/rewind/paths.py b/rewind/paths.py index 7a538c8..11de312 100644 --- a/rewind/paths.py +++ b/rewind/paths.py @@ -1,5 +1,8 @@ +#!/usr/bin/env python3 +import os +import json +import tomllib from pathlib import Path -import os, json, tomllib from importlib import resources APP_NAME = "rewind" diff --git a/rewind/video.py b/rewind/video.py index 8896a83..6961dad 100644 --- a/rewind/video.py +++ b/rewind/video.py @@ -1,5 +1,7 @@ -import os, subprocess, datetime - +#!/usr/bin/env python3 +import os +import datetime +import subprocess from rewind.paths import load_state def combine_last_x_ts_files(seconds: float, output_file: str) -> None: